Jacqueline Kay (Coleman) Carl, 73, of Wattersonville, died Saturday, April 7, 2018, at Good Samaritan Hospice in Cabot. She was born January 19, 1945, in Shannondale, Pa., to Jack B. and Ina (Champion) Coleman. Jacqueline was a retired special education teacher, working at Mt. Lebanon and Armstrong area schools. She was a member of Wattersonville United Methodist Church. Jacqueline enjoyed boating, the outdoors, laughing with her grandchildren, and Jeopardy. She took great pride in her home and property. Left behind to cherish her memory is her mother, Ina Coleman, of Somerville, Pa; son, Gregory (Sheena) Carl, of Saxonburg; daughter, Gretchen Carl, of Canonsburg; granddaughter, Emily Carl, of Saxonburg; grandsons, Logan Carl, of Saxonburg, and Tommy, Mikey, and Anthony Lento, all of Canonsburg; and brother, Marc Coleman, of Somerville, Pa. She was preceded in death by her father; husband, Steven Carl; and sister, Ruthann (Coleman) Wingard.
